The Physician's Statement (Form MV-80) is a medical report used by the New York State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) to evaluate a driver's fitness to safely operate a motor vehicle when a medical condition other than loss of consciousness is reported. This document is typically required during the driver license application or renewal process if a medical condition is disclosed, or as part of a driver re-evaluation program following a police report, accident, or reliable report from a third party.
The form must be completed by a licensed healthcare provider—such as a physician, physician assistant, or nurse practitioner—based on a physical examination conducted within the last six months. It requires the professional to detail the patient's medical history, current medications, and their clinical opinion on whether the patient's condition interferes with safe driving. If the medical professional indicates the patient is unfit or if the form is not submitted in a timely manner, the DMV may suspend the individual's driving privileges until an acceptable statement is provided.
